Planning to attend the Southeastern Wildlife Exposition (SEWE) in Charleston, South Carolina?

Every February, SEWE transforms the Lowcountry into a celebration of wildlife art, outdoor living, and conservation. Visitors can explore world-class art exhibits, live demonstrations, sporting dog events, and family-friendly activities throughout downtown Charleston’s historic venues.

SEWE Sculpture Initiative at Memorial Waterfront Park

Mount Pleasant proudly shares its connection to SEWE through the SEWE Sculpture Initiative at Memorial Waterfront Park. This stunning art installation features life-sized bronze sculptures celebrating wildlife and the region’s natural beauty. It’s a can’t-miss stop for art lovers visiting the Charleston area. While you’re there, take a stroll along the Mount Pleasant Pier, enjoy breathtaking views of the Charleston Harbor, and experience the local wildlife up close.
